In terms of installation, drainage mat walls are relatively easy to incorporate into new construction or retrofit onto existing structures. These mats are typically made from durable materials such as plastic or rubber, and can be installed quickly and easily by trained professionals. Once in place, they require minimal maintenance and can provide long-lasting protection against water damage.

Drain cell mats, also known as drainage cells or drainage boards, are lightweight, high-strength materials designed to promote efficient water drainage and aeration in landscaping and construction applications. Generally made from recycled plastics, these mats feature a series of interconnected cells that create space for water to flow through, preventing oversaturation of soil and improving the overall health of plants.
Caring for a pebble bathtub mat is surprisingly simple. Most mats can be washed with mild soap and water, and some are even suitable for machine washing. It is important, however, to ensure the mat dries thoroughly after cleaning to prevent mold or mildew. Regular maintenance will keep the stones looking vibrant and fresh while maintaining the mat's overall durability.

Once the new seal is installed, close your oven door and check for gaps. You can do this by performing a simple test place a piece of paper between the door and the oven. If you can pull it out easily with the door closed, the seal needs further adjustment.

Weather strips are flexible seals placed around the doors, windows, and trunk of a vehicle. Their primary purpose is to prevent water, dust, and air from entering the car. However, they play an equally critical role in sound insulation. By providing a resilient barrier against external noise, soundproof weather strips help create a quieter cabin environment.

One of the primary benefits of self-adhesive foam weatherstrip seals is their ability to improve energy efficiency. Homes lose a significant amount of heating and cooling through gaps and cracks. By applying these weatherstrips, homeowners can reduce their energy costs by ensuring that their heating and cooling systems do not have to work harder to maintain the desired temperature.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, sealing gaps and cracks can lead to energy savings of up to 20%.

Rubber door edge protectors are designed to cushion and shield the sharp edges of doors. Typically made from high-quality rubber, these protectors are flexible, durable, and can absorb a considerable amount of impact. They come in various shapes and sizes, catering to different types of doors, from traditional hinged doors to sliding ones. This versatility makes them suitable for homes, schools, hospitals, and numerous commercial spaces.
Another significant advantage of high-quality car door seal trim is its ability to reduce noise levels within the cabin. Outside noises, such as traffic, construction, or even the sound of wind, can be distracting during drives. Well-fitted seals can dampen these external sounds, creating a quieter and more enjoyable driving experience. This is especially valuable for long trips where driver fatigue can be exacerbated by constant background noise.

The 40mm designation refers to the diameter of the shaft that the seal is designed to fit. This size is commonly used in smaller pumps and machinery, making it a versatile component for various applications. The efficiency of the mechanical seal hinges on the quality of its materials and the precision of its construction. Common materials used include carbon, ceramic, and different types of elastomers, each selected based on the specific fluid being sealed and the operational conditions.
